Chi-Chi Olivo Baseball player

Federico Emilio "Chi-Chi" Olivo Maldonado (March 28, 1928 – February 3, 1977) was a Major League Baseball pitcher. He pitched all or part of four seasons in the majors, between 1961 and 1966, for the Milwaukee and Atlanta Braves. He appeared in 96 games during his career, all in relief.Chi-Chi's brother, Diomedes Olivo, was also a Major League pitcher.
